Access Capital with a Business Line of Credit

A business line of credit can offer as a valuable asset for entrepreneurs and established businesses. Unlike a traditional loan, a line of credit allows you to borrow funds as necessary, up to a predetermined ceiling. This flexibility makes it an ideal solution for managing cash flow. You can utilize the line of credit for a variety of purposes, such as covering operating costs, investing in technology, or even seizing unexpected expenses.

  • Strengths of a business line of credit include:
  • Improved cash flow management
  • Agility to access funds when needed
  • Elevated creditworthiness over time with responsible use

Unleash Business Funding with a Merchant Cash Advance

Need capital to expand your business? A merchant cash advance could be the solution you've been searching for. This alternative funding method provides businesses with a injection of capital based on your future income. Unlike traditional loans, merchant cash advances don't require a financial review, making them an attractive option for businesses of all shapes.

  • Restore your working funds
  • Upgrade your business operations
  • Manage unexpected needs

With a merchant cash advance, you repay the loan through a percentage of your future sales transactions. This makes it an effective approach to access the funding you need when you need it most.

Pros and Cons of SBA Loans for Entrepreneurs

Securing funding for a small business can be challenging, but the Small Business Administration (SBA) offers various loan programs designed more info to support entrepreneurs. While SBA loans come with possible benefits, it's essential to meticulously consider both the pros and cons before submitting an application.

  • Significant advantage of an SBA loan is the competitive interest rates, which are typically reduced compared to conventional loans. This can greatly reduce your monthly payments and free up cash flow for other business needs.

  • SBA loans also offer diverse repayment terms, allowing you to customize a plan that matches your financial situation. Furthermore, the SBA provides advice and mentorship throughout the loan process, assisting you navigate obstacles.

  • However, SBA loans also have disadvantages to consider. The application process can be time-consuming, requiring comprehensive documentation and careful examination.

  • Moreover, SBA loans may have more rigorous eligibility requirements than conventional loans. You'll need to demonstrate a strong business plan, good financial standing, and valuable security.

It's essential to carefully weigh the pros and cons of an SBA loan before making a decision.
